Kenia Mugaya

About This Coffee

This single-origin coffee comes from the Kirinyaga region of Kenya, grown at 1700-1800 meters altitude. It is sourced from approximately 1700 small farmers who deliver cherries daily to the Mugaya Coffee Factory, located on the southern outskirts of Mt. Kenya National Park. The coffee features SL28 and SL34 varieties and is washed processed. The flavor profile is characterized by intense currant notes, with grapefruit and delicate passion fruit undertones. It has a sweet, dense body and fresh, classic Kenyan characteristics. The coffee is grown on volcanic, fertile soil in small plots averaging 0.1 hectares, often intercropped with corn, legumes, potatoes, and other vegetables.

Good Coffee Micro Roasters

Good Coffee Micro Roasters operates in Warsaw, Poland, where founder Wojtek has been crafting quality specialty coffee for years through a grassroots approach focused on word of mouth rather than heavy marketing. The roastery specializes in small batch, single-origin coffees that showcase the unique characteristics of their carefully sourced beans. Their natural process Rwanda coffee has earned recognition among specialty coffee enthusiasts in the region. Good Coffee serves the local coffee community through direct sales and partnerships with select cafés throughout Warsaw.
